Beverage and tobacco manufacturing (NAICS 3121) air sources in Georgia
- 8Facilities
Permitted air-emissions sources in Georgia whose primary industry code is NAICS 3121. A facility filing more than one industry code is counted under the first one on its record, so a plant with several lines appears once, under the line EPA lists first.
Inspections of beverage and tobacco manufacturing (naics 3121) in Georgia, by year
A compliance evaluation is the on-site or file review a state, local or federal air agency records against a permitted source.
- 2026 — inspections 5
- 2025 — inspections 8
- 2024 — inspections 13
- 2023 — inspections 8
- 2022 — inspections 11
- 2021 — inspections 8
- 2020 — inspections 13
- 2019 — inspections 10
- 2018 — inspections 10
- 2017 — inspections 9
